近年來LED顯示技術發展迅速,LED全彩顯示屏得到了廣泛的應用.LED顯示技術涵蓋了微機控制、視頻、光學、機械和數字圖像處理等多種技術.針對現有LED顯示系統數據傳輸和顯示存在的缺陷和開發難度,本文提出并實現了一種新型的LED顯示系統方案.該方案把ARM處理器應用到LED顯示屏中,采用FPGA技術開發了LED顯示屏系統.本文主要討論了利用網絡傳輸LED顯示數據的實現方法,包括嵌入式系統的設計以及TCP/IP協議的實現等分析和設計工作.全文分為七章,首先提出現有LED顯示系統數據傳輸和顯示存在的缺陷和開發難度,然后提出新的LED顯示系統方案,并論證該方案的可行性.接著闡述了作者采用的嵌入式系統的設計方法和過程.第三章和第四章是嵌入式系統的設計和TCP/IP協議的實現,其中包括硬件和軟件的設計以及嵌入式操作系統μ C/OS-Ⅱ的移植.詳細地分析了基于LPC2214芯片的操作系統移植步驟和過程.本文使用的是1wIP網關協議,把其應用于μ C/OS-Ⅱ,實現了LED顯示屏的網絡通信,還分析了RTL8019芯片的工作過程,編寫了有關驅動代碼.在第五章和第六章中闡述了LED顯示屏顯示原理和利用FPGA實現LED顯示的驅動開發過程,利用占空比法實現LED顯示屏的灰度顯示,使用VHDL語言描述LED顯示屏的灰度實現邏輯.最后根據本文的方案實現了LED顯示屏的彩色顯示,通過分析比較,該方案可行并且達到了預定的要求.
上傳時間: 2013-04-24
上傳用戶:yoleeson
在精密乘法器設計中采用AD630整流放大器:
上傳時間: 2013-07-10
上傳用戶:zhyiroy
本課題源于空中機器人大賽參賽項目。針對比賽要求,提出了一種基于ARM的低成本、高性能的嵌入式微小無人機飛行控制系統的整體方案,并由此展開了一系列的研究工作。 本文的重點是飛行控制系統的姿態確定系統設計和飛行控制系統的硬件設計及實現。 本文首先回顧了國內外微小無人機發展歷程,介紹了其研究現狀,并指出了微小無人機的發展趨勢。根據需求設計了低價位、高性能的嵌入式微小無人機飛行控制系統的整體方案。 設計了低成本、低功耗的微小無人機的姿態確定系統方案,利用姿態四元數、龍格庫塔法、高斯牛頓法和擴展卡爾曼濾波器估計出系統的姿態矩陣;對姿態確定方案進行了仿真。 設計了基于ARM的飛行控制系統的硬件部分,包括電源及復位電路,UART、SPI、JTAG等接口電路,PWM信號發生電路,A/D采樣電路及前置電路,光電耦合電路等;完成了整個飛控系統PCB板制作以及對所設計電路的調試工作,使得系統運轉正常。 最后針對本文設計的硬件平臺進行了啟動代碼等系統底層軟件的編寫和調試,建立了系統的啟動環境。
上傳時間: 2013-06-03
上傳用戶:kgylah
這篇應用指南的目標讀者是數字 系統設計師,他們在研發過程中會用 到模擬和數字元器件,包括采用串行 總線的微控制器和DSP系統。本文討 論調試串行總線設計所面臨的挑戰和 新的解決方案,這些串行總線包括控 制器局域網 (CAN)、集成電路間總線 (I2C)、串行外設接口 (SPI) 或通用串行 總線 (USB)。
上傳時間: 2013-06-15
上傳用戶:user08x
本文研制的數據采集器,用于采集導彈過載模擬試車臺的各種參數,來評價導彈在飛行過程中的性能,由于試車臺是高速旋轉體,其工作環境惡劣,受電磁干擾大,而且設備要求高,如果遇到設備故障或設備事故,其損失相當巨大,保證設備的安全性和可靠性較為困難。 本文在分析數字通信技術的基礎上,選用了基于現場可編程邏輯陣列(FPGA)采用脈沖編碼調制(PCM)通信實現多路數據采集器的設計,其優點是FPGA技術在數據采集器中可以進行模塊化設計,增加了系統的抗干擾性、靈活性和適應性,并且可以將整個PCM通信系統設計成可編程序系統,用戶只要稍加變更程序,則系統的被測路數、幀結構、碼速率、標度等均可改變以適應任何場合。并且采用合理的糾錯和加密編碼能夠實現數據在傳輸工程中的完整性和安全性。 通過對PCM通信的特點研究,研制了一套集采集與傳輸的系統。文章給出了各個模塊的具體建模與設計,系統采用的是FPGA技術來實現數據采集和信號處理,采用VHDL實現了數字復接器和分接器、編解碼器、調制與解調模塊的建模與設計。采用基于NiosII實現串口通訊,構建了實時性和準確性通信網絡,實現了數據的采集。 測試數據和數據采集的實驗結果證明,采用FPGA技術實現PCM信號的編碼、傳輸、解碼,能夠有較強的抗干擾性、抗噪聲性能好、差錯可控、易加密、易與現代技術結合,并且誤碼率較低,要遠遠優于傳統的方法。
上傳時間: 2013-04-24
上傳用戶:com1com2
礦用隔爆饋電開關是煤礦井下配電系統的關鍵設備,作為配電開關,用于含有瓦斯或煤塵等爆炸危險環境的礦井中,控制和保護低壓供電網絡。其性能好壞直接影響著煤礦井下的生產安全和生產效率,而目前國內饋電開關普遍存在集成度低、可靠性差、智能監控水平低等缺點。 本課題將嵌入式網絡控制系統應用到饋電開關中,通過對礦山供電系統工作原理、真空饋電開關工作原理以及基于EasyARM2200(Philips LPC2210為處理器、ARM7為內核)嵌入式網絡控制系統的研究,實現了總體網絡拓撲結構的設計和智能饋電開關控制系統硬件電路的設計;通過對嵌入式實時操作系統的移植、嵌入式TCP/IP協議棧的實現和移植以及基于C/S模式下的套接字編程等的研究和分析,完成了監控主機與嵌入式系統的通信軟件和保護控制算法的應用程序的編寫,從而實現了礦井地面監控主機與井下嵌入式系統饋電開關的快速通信,解決了地面監控主機對井下饋電回路及電氣開關的遠程智能監控的難題,最終設計出一套集實時保護控制和遠程監控功能于一身的智能型饋電開關網絡控制系統。 實驗結果表明:在嵌入式系統端的通信軟件和監控主機端的通信軟件的驅動下,實現了嵌入式系統與監控主機的快速遠程通信,通信速度快、可靠性高、可視化效果好,完全滿足了監控系統的快速通信要求。 本課題的研究成果為工業控制領域提供了一個開放式、全分布、可互操作性的通信控制平臺,為提高煤礦井下設備的遠程智能監控水平和安全操控系數提供了新的解決方法,為地面監控系統實現更大規模、更深層次地對井下電氣設備的集中控制、分散管理奠定了理論和實踐基礎。
上傳時間: 2013-06-25
上傳用戶:wl9454
傳感器是測控系統的重要組成部分,但有些傳感器,如增量式或絕對式旋轉編碼器,因無配套的二次儀表,給使用帶來不便。有些傳感器雖然可以買到配套的儀表,但價格昂貴,功能單一且功能無法擴展。為此,本課題以設計一種通用性強,功能擴展方便的測量儀表為目的,將計算機技術與嵌入式微處理器技術用于測量儀表當中,設計一種基于ARM的嵌入式智能儀表。課題主要研究工作包括: 1.在分析比較各種二次儀表功能的基礎上,提出了基于ARM的嵌入式智能儀表設計方案。搭建了儀表的硬件平臺。 2.軟件設計實現了μC/OS-Ⅱ嵌入式系統在ARM7微控制器上的移植。在此基礎上,對嵌入式系統進行了一定的擴展,編寫了LCD驅動程序,調用了串口通信,A/D轉換等模塊的API函數,建立了多任務環境,使儀表兼具PWM脈寬調制功能、數據采集、顯示和傳輸功能。 3.通過增量式、絕對式旋轉編碼器實驗、轉矩轉速傳感器實驗、輸出模擬信號的角度傳感器實驗和PWM輸出實驗驗證儀表的功能。 RTOS平臺的構建,降低了軟件設計的復雜度,提高了系統的實時性和靈活性,縮短了開發周期。經過實驗驗證,該儀表能夠準確測定頻率信號、模擬信號及數字信號。
上傳時間: 2013-04-24
上傳用戶:1234567890qqq
高端濕熱環境試驗箱的溫濕度控制器有著如下特點:①、人機接口模塊大多采用彩色液晶屏和觸摸屏;②、控制器存儲容量大,可存儲大量溫濕度數據;⑧、溫濕度數據測量精度高;④、溫濕度控制精度高,具有自調整能力,可根據試驗條件的變化調節控制器內部參數。⑤、輔助功能多,如RS232串口通訊、USB通訊、以太網通訊等,方便和PC機的連接。此種類型的溫濕度控制器國內生產較少。 本文在綜述國內溫濕度控制技術的基礎上,提出了基于ARM9芯片的高性能溫濕度控制的設計方法。本文主要針對以下幾個方面進行了研究:研究試驗箱內熱力學過程并建立溫濕度控制系統的簡化數學模型;分析溫濕度控制箱的控制方法,選擇合理的溫濕度測量方案,提出了減少誤差的方法;分析溫濕度控制器的功能需求,完成了基于ARM的溫濕度控制器的硬件設計和調試;選擇了溫濕度控制系統的控制算法,并在設計的硬件平臺上實現;最后對控制效果進行了試驗分析。 本論文各章節主要內容概述如下: 第1章綜述了濕熱環境試驗設備技術和嵌入式系統技術進展,提出了課題的研究內容、難點和創新點。 第2章分析了濕熱環境試驗箱溫濕度控制的控制算法,分析了被控空氣的熱力學過程,得出簡化數學模型。 第3章對溫度、濕度測量系統及其誤差消除方法進行分析,提出基于AD7711的高精度溫濕度測量方案。 第4章分析溫濕度控制器的需求,完成溫濕度控制器硬件平臺的設計。 第5章研究溫濕度控制系統的控制算法,在硬件平臺上實現PID繼電自整定算法。 第6章對溫濕度控制的實際控制效果進行試驗分析。 第7章總結與展望。
上傳時間: 2013-04-24
上傳用戶:bjgaofei
通過駐極體話筒對音樂聲量進行采集后,把采集的信號進行放大整流濾波,并通過555構成的壓控振蕩器把音樂的聲量信號轉化成變化的振蕩頻率,即通過聲量的大小來產生相應頻率的振蕩信號,再經過二進制計數器對該振蕩輸出的脈沖進行計數輸出四種不同的狀態,通過二-四譯碼器對計數器輸出狀態進行譯碼產生相應的選通信號控制燈流接口電路 ,接口電路驅動一列信號指示燈,實現燈流速度隨音樂聲量大小而相應變化的效果。
上傳時間: 2013-04-24
上傳用戶:362279997
嵌入式系統是一種將底層硬件、實時操作系統和應用軟件相結合的專用計算機系統,在經濟社會和人們的日常生活中得到了越來越廣泛的應用。嵌入式系統的研究與開發已成為現代電子領域的重要研究方向之一。嵌入式實時操作系統是嵌入式系統應用軟件開發的支撐平臺,網絡化是主要趨勢之一。 μC/OS-Ⅱ作為一種新興的嵌入式實時操作系統,以其免費公開源碼、面向中小型應用、可搶占、多任務以及較好的移植性等突出特點,在各類嵌入式設備中得到廣泛應用。然而,μC/OS-Ⅱ內核中不支持TCP/IP協議棧,因而無法適應嵌入式設備網絡化的需要。本文的主要目標是:在計算資源嚴重受限的條件下,研究使嵌入式系統支持TCP/IP協議的策略及其實現方法。 本課題以實驗室現有的Samsung S3C44BOX芯片為核心的ARM開發板作為硬件平臺,分析了ARM7TDM[內核的特點及S3C44BOX的結構。在詳細分析實時操作系統μC/OS-Ⅱ及其內核原理的基礎上對其進行適當的改進并成功移植到ARM硬件平臺上。針對μC/OS-Ⅱ內核不支持TCP/IP協議棧的問題,引進了嵌入式TCP/IP協議uIP,將其應用到μC/OS-Ⅱ上,成為μC/OS-Ⅱ的網絡服務模塊,實現了對μC/OS-Ⅱ的網絡功能的擴充,并在uIP基礎上編寫了相關的網絡驅動程序。最后,本課題設計了基于HTTP協議的嵌入式Web服務器和基于TFTP協議的遠程文件傳輸,從而使網絡遠程監控測量和在線程序的更新下載成為現實。 本課題經過數月的軟硬件的設計和調試,已實現了最初的設計目標。測試結果表明:移植到ARM處理器上的μC/OS-Ⅱ內核可以成功實現對任務的調度;對μC/OS-Ⅱ內核擴充的TCP/IP協議——uIP可正常運行:嵌入式Web服務器和遠、程文件傳輸在實驗室局域網中的穩定運行,更加證明了本課題的成功性。
上傳時間: 2013-05-17
上傳用戶:LSPSL